[QUOTE]Originally posted by Morpheus: [QB] Here are some observations from MacEachern on Baker's work as cited by Rushton: [i]He further (Rushton 2000: 142) makes use of John Baker's (1974) racist and unsystematic list of twenty-one 'criteria for civilization'- which begins to evaluate cultural advance by scoring the amount of clothing that people wear and ends with criteria like 'some appreciation of the fine arts' - in order to dismiss African and American cultural achievements.[/i] [b]Source:[/b] Africanist Archaeology and Ancient IQ: Racial Science and Cultural Evolution in the Twenty-First Century World Archaeology, Vol. 38, No. 1, Race, Racism and Archaeology (Mar., 2006), pp. 72-92 [/QB][/QUOTE]
